This is the spectacular moment a huge lightning bolt illuminated an expressway as a storm rolled in.

Footage shows the vivid lightning strike touching down near the North Luzon Expressway in Pampanga province, the Philippines on May 22.

Driver Dan Contreras said: 'We were so surprised because it struck so close. We could feel the vibrations from the thunder inside the car.'

Lightning is caused by electrical imbalances between the clouds and the ground. About 100 cloud-to-ground bolts strike the Earth every second, with each bolt containing up to a billion volts of electricity.
